6,6-Difluoro-2-azaspiro[3.3]heptane (CAS No. 1427367-47-2) is a highly specialized spirocyclic compound with the molecular formula C6H9F2N. This unique structure features a difluorinated azaspiro framework, making it a valuable building block in medicinal chemistry and pharmaceutical research. The compound’s rigid spirocyclic core and fluorine substitution enhance its potential as a scaffold for drug discovery, particularly in the development of bioactive molecules targeting CNS disorders and enzyme modulation. With a purity grade suitable for research applications, this product is supplied in a secure, tamper-evident package to ensure stability and integrity. Ideal for high-throughput screening (HTS) and structure-activity relationship (SAR) studies, it is a must-have for synthetic chemists and R&D laboratories.
- CAS No: 1427367-47-2
- Molecular Formula: C6H9F2N
- Molecular Weight: 133.14
- Exact Mass: 133.07030562
- Monoisotopic Mass: 133.07030562
- IUPAC Name: 6,6-difluoro-2-azaspiro[3.3]heptane
- SMILES: C1C2(CC1(F)F)CNC2
- Synonyms: 6,6-difluoro-2-azaspiro[3.3]heptane, 1354952-05-8, 6,6-Difluoro-2-aza-spiro[3.3]heptane, SCHEMBL14671147, HSTZDPVQCODIFA-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Application
6,6-Difluoro-2-azaspiro[3.3]heptane is primarily used as a key intermediate in the synthesis of novel pharmacophores, particularly for CNS-targeting therapeutics. Its spirocyclic architecture and fluorine atoms contribute to improved metabolic stability and binding affinity in drug candidates. Researchers leverage this compound to explore new chemical space in fragment-based drug design (FBDD) and peptidomimetics. It is also employed in the development of fluorinated analogs for PET imaging probes.
